Dominic McLaughlin, the young actor stepping into Harry Potter’s iconic robes for HBO’s upcoming series, was thrilled to receive a personal letter from Daniel Radcliffe.

The rising star, who landed the coveted role after a massive global search, said he was travelling home to Glasgow when his dad quietly handed him a letter that left him stunned. 

During an appearance on BBC’s Saturday Mash-Up! Live, McLaughlin said he instantly recognised the sender.

He recalled trying to stay calm on the packed train as he reached the signature: “Dan R.” 

“It was insane,” he said, adding that he “went mad on the inside” but forced himself to keep it together in public.

McLaughlin also shared that filming on the new adaptation is going “amazing,” with the cast quickly bonding on set. 

Radcliffe, meanwhile, recently revealed he wanted to offer a few encouraging words to the new generation of wizards, admitting the child actors “just seem so young,” and that he hopes they’re having the time of their lives.

McLaughlin was unveiled as the new Harry in May, beating out thousands of hopefuls. 

More than 32,000 children auditioned for the trio, with Alastair Stout and Arabella Stanton joining him as Ron Weasley and Hermione Granger.
